Alabama authorities searching for an inmate and the corrections officer who removed him from jail
CNN
Authorities in Lauderdale County, Alabama, are searching for a corrections officer and an inmate charged with murder who went missing Friday morning.
Vicki White, assistant director of corrections at the Lauderdale County Sheriff's Office, and inmate Casey White were last seen about 9:30 a.m. Friday when she removed him from the jail, supposedly to take him to the county courthouse for a mental evaluation, Lauderdale County Sheriff Rick Singleton said. The officer and the inmate are not related.
Vicki White told a guard she was going to drop off Casey White at the courthouse and seek medical care because she wasn't feeling well.
